Stay near popular Goto attractions

Mizunoura Church

8.4/10 (6 reviews)
This striking white wooden church blends Romanesque, Gothic, and Japanese design elements on Goto Islands. Inside, experience serene reflection while overlooking the blue sea from its hillside perch.

Maejima Island Tombolo

This natural gravel path connecting Maejima and Suetsushima islands emerges only during low tide. Walk the 300-meter tombolo for a serene experience amid the beautiful Goto archipelago of Nagasaki.

Tamanoura Church

8.4/10 (5 reviews)
Japan's first Lourdes grotto resides at Tamanoura Catholic Church, built in 1899 using stones from across the Goto Islands. Visit during the May Lourdes Festival when pilgrims gather to honour the Virgin Mary.

Best time to go to Goto

The best time to visit Goto is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with moderate r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ather in Goto?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 11°C. The rainiest months in Goto are June, September, July and August, with each month seeing an average of 292 mm of rainfall.
